Having played together since they were teens, sisters Júlia and Maria Reis make a hazy noise rock/punk as Pega Monstro that's hard to sit down to.
Lisbon, Portugal natives, Júlia Reis plays drums while Maria handles guitar and keyboard, and both sing their melodic, Portuguese-language tunes, heavy with reverb and crash cymbals. Their debut EP, O Juno-60 Nunca Teve Fita, appeared in early 2011 and was followed by a B Fachada-produced self-titled LP on their own Cafetra Records in 2012. After earning a reputation for energetic live shows and support spots for acts including Ariel Pink and the Jon Spencer Blues Explosion, Pega Monstro released their second LP Alfarroba ("carob") via Upset the Rhythm in the summer of 2015. ~ Marcy Donelson
